Default Wheel size A7 to A6

Hey guys,

I'm getting ready to put on the winter tires/wheels on my A6.

I was looking to get Audi replica rims from Costco.ca, but they do not list Audi A6 just A7. I was wondering if anyone know if the 18 inch wheel size (front/rear axis, bolt pattern, center bore) for A7 is same as on A6. And if the rim will clear the caliper.

Thanks!

Go to TireRack and put a wheel package together. Write down the data that they provide and find other wheels with the same specs.

You will need:
wheel size: I have 17's for my 2012 A7 winter set
Bolt Pattern:5x112
Hub Bore: 66.56 mm
Offset (ET):
wheel width:

I bought my A7 in late November so I didn't have any time to research wheel sizing. TireRack said the 17's would fit over my 3.0L calipers and they did. I chose a dark color to hide the dirt and added some red motorcycle wheel tape to dress them up a bit.

Originally Posted by snagitseven
Not positive but I believe the wheel offsets are different for the A7. You could do a search.
I know my 2012 A7 20 inch wheels have a offset of 37mm. The numbers are stamped on the hub and I took pictures when they were off the car.

From my notes, the A6 20 inch wheels have a offset of 39mm. There is a difference but not much. The OP should check his OEM wheel hub to see if the sizes are still valid.

Rule of thumb is to check the fitment on a front hub for clearance before mounting a tire. Wheel vendors will not accept a wheel that has had a tire mounted on it as a return.
